Donations from Acadiana are making their way out to those volunteers searching for the missing Seacor Power crew members.
The Jeanerette Fire Department says that donations sent to them by community members for search volunteers.
On Friday, the Fire Department loaded up a trailer of donations that will be going to the crews searching. Earlier this week, the department requested items such as water, sunscreen and bug spray among others.
They say they are thankful for the donations from everyone and will continue to accept them as long as there is a need. The Fire Department is in contact with those searching and will update when donations are no longer needed.
